I recycle plastic, glass, newspapers, and mixed paper which is not a simple thing because my condo complex does not offer recycling. I make a trip to the recycling center at CSULB every few weeks which is a pain but it's important to me. I switched to a reusable water bottle a while ago but I still buy plastic bottles of fuzzy water. I'm switching to CFLs as lightbulbs burn out.

My concern about recycling has made it almost impossible for me to just throw stuff in the trash. Taking old stuff to Goodwill is work all by itself so I'm much more careful about buying useless stuff.

Personally I think the fearmongers aren't scaring us enough.
